Transaction 16331ae74629936b441ab6f316628c663ce37491c58ea92ad570db7ddff05e39
1 Input
2 Outputs
- 16331ae74629936b441ab6f316628c663ce37491c58ea92ad570db7ddff05e39:0
- 16331ae74629936b441ab6f316628c663ce37491c58ea92ad570db7ddff05e39:1
value 223669
address 3LmVdbyaTBo4KWaJaW5mVwAVsZKWY2eJp7
value 5166543
address 1QGG3NqkQWinaxyLkuesRQFdw7JNA2nwwb